He sits patiently, upon gilded throne
Defying withering and aging of bone
On surface, all appears calm and steady
Unchanging as stone, forever ready
Appearing as an eccentric sage
Time holds no meaning for the cryptic mage
Beneath, his mind, fractured by time
Is a final haven, his sole lair
He can sleep, he can eat, he can talk, he can blink
But most dangerous of all, he can think
Think, for lack of a better word
His thoughts float free, unhindered but blurred
He gazes ironically
At the shifting world
Peering jealously
At what destiny unfurled
His eyes, long gone
Stare at naught but time
He watches churlishly, blasé and wanton
Unable to see miracles sublime
The threads of time curl round his form
An unstoppable, immeasurable, mighty storm
He plays with them, then casts them back
Far from their intended track
Master of Time, Ruler of All
Waiting for eternity in his intangible hall
Chronos is cruel, Chronos is fey
A raving lunatic with feet of clay
Chronos is cruel, Chronos is biased
With powers to contradict King Midas
Everything he touches turns stark grey
Chronos is cruel, Chronos is fey

Accept your Candle, Weep for the Stars
A light I see, far off in the distance. It's a star, I told myself.
No other thought surpassed it, I want to reach it.
I struggle in the darkness, slowly heading for it, not knowing, not thinking.
I know this is what I want. I want the star.
It gets brighter, I can feel its warm touch, though I'm far from it.
Joy overwhelms my soul, I'm so close, so close to
my star. It's my star and nothing else matters.
I reach with my fingers, to touch it.
A candle. A lowly candle, my thoughts shattered.
This is not what I wanted. It's not my star.
I blink, and blink again, I see clearly. Up above.
There are hundreds, no millions of stars.
Why
